On this week's episode of Sound Bites, Functional Medicine Practitioner, Dr Kirstin Lauritzen, covers our next nutrient highlight: Iron. Unfortunately, many athletes discover how essential iron is the difficult way. Iron deficiency and the subsequent iron deficiency anemia can create a lot of havoc for an athlete. Women are far more susceptible because of menstruation, but men can still get this too. There are many reasons why an athlete can become deficient in iron, from dietary habits, to training requirements, to sweat loss and a lot more. Although many athletes have heard about this or potentially experienced this themselves, it’s worth learning more about it as the signs and symptoms of deficiency can be caught early and treated. In this episode Dr K discusses what coaches, athletes and practitioners need to be looking for when it comes to the tell tale signs of an iron deficiency. Dr K also covers a few treatment options as well as, of course, where you can find it in food! We hope you enjoy this episode of Sound Bites.
